What is a Small Mobility Scooter?
A small mobility scooter is a compact, motorized car created to assist individuals with mobility difficulties. Generally, these scooters are smaller and more maneuverable than their bigger equivalents, making them perfect for usage in tight areas such as homes, stores, and narrow pathways. They are often battery-powered and come with features such as adjustable seats, easy-to-use controls, and different security systems.
Benefits of Small Mobility Scooters
Boosted Mobility: Small mobility scooters supply a way for people with minimal mobility to travel longer ranges without fatigue. This can considerably enhance their ability to take part in social activities and keep an active lifestyle.

Self-reliance: For many users, a mobility scooter is a symbol of self-reliance. It allows them to perform day-to-day tasks and travel to numerous areas without counting on others for assistance.

Alleviate of Use: Small mobility scooters are developed with easy to use controls, making them simple to run. Many designs feature instinctive interfaces and basic steering systems, making sure that even novice users can rapidly adjust.

Portability: Due to their compact size, small mobility scooters are often simpler to transport. Some models can be disassembled or folded, making them ideal for travel in cars and trucks, public transport, or storage in small areas.

Price: Compared to larger mobility automobiles, small scooters are generally more affordable. This makes them accessible to a wider variety of people, including those on a spending plan.
Key Features to Consider When Buying a Small Mobility Scooter
When looking for a small mobility scooter, it's necessary to consider the following features to guarantee you find the right model for your requirements:

Battery Life: Look for a scooter with a battery that provides sufficient variety for your everyday activities. Consider how typically you will require to charge the battery and whether the scooter has a quick-charging choice.

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support your weight. A lot of small mobility scooters have a weight capacity ranging from 200 to 300 pounds, however this can differ by design.

Speed and Range: The speed and variety of the scooter are crucial aspects. Some models can travel approximately 15 miles per charge and have a top speed of 5 to 8 miles per hour.

Safety Features: Safety is critical. Look for features such as anti-tip wheels, seat belts, and reputable braking systems. Some designs also feature lights and reflectors for presence in low-light conditions.

Adjustability: An adjustable seat and handlebars can enhance comfort and make sure a proper fit. Think about whether the scooter uses choices for changing the height and angle of the seat and handlebars.

Warranty and Customer Support: A great service warranty and trusted consumer assistance can provide comfort. Try to find a manufacturer that provides a comprehensive guarantee and has a track record for responsive client service.

Frequently Asked Questions About Small Mobility Scooters
Q: Are small mobility scooters ideal for indoor usage?A: Yes, small mobility scooters are designed to be utilized both inside and outdoors. Their compact size and maneuverability make them perfect for browsing tight areas such as homes, stores, and offices.

Q: How easy is it to transport a small mobility scooter?A: Many small mobility scooters are created with mobility in mind. They can be disassembled or folded for easy transport in a vehicle or on mass transit. Some designs even come with carrying cases for added benefit.

Q: Can I utilize a small mobility scooter on uneven surface?A: While small mobility scooters are generally developed for usage on smooth surfaces, some designs can handle light off-road conditions. However, it's important to select a design with durable wheels and a robust frame if you plan to use it on uneven surface.

Q: How do I keep a small mobility scooter?A: Regular maintenance is important to ensure the durability and performance of your mobility scooter. This consists of charging the battery frequently, examining the tires for wear and tear, and cleaning the scooter to prevent dirt and particles from impacting its efficiency. It's likewise a great idea to speak with the producer's maintenance guide for particular directions.

Q: Are there any legal requirements for using a small mobility scooter?A: Legal requirements for using a mobility scooter can vary by area. In many places, mobility scooters are classified as individual mobility gadgets and do not need a chauffeur's license or registration. Nevertheless, it's essential to examine local regulations to ensure compliance with any particular rules or standards.
